14.18 PAINTING.
All fabricated steel material shall receive one shop coat of anti-
corrosive paint after having been thoroughly cleaned of all loose mill scales, rust
and foreign matter. Machine finished surfaces shall be coated with white lead
and yellow before dispatch. Paint shall be applied at temperature of 4-5o C or
lower. Paint shall be stirred frequently to keep the pigment in suspension. One
additional coat of read lead paint shall be applied for all steel work after erection.
The interior surfaces of box sections and surfaces in accessible after assembly
or erection, shall be thoroughly cleaned and painted with two coats of red lead
paint or any other anti-corrosive paint, before assembly.
Any steel scratches during erection shall be touched up after erection with lead
paint.
All bright parts shall be applied with suitable rust preventive paint which can be
easily removed during erection.
